Description

Notice of Intent to Single-Source: The 49th Contracting Squadron (CONS) – Holloman Air Force Base, New Mexico intends to issue a single-source award to AKS Industries Inc under the authority of FAR 6.302-1(2). 

This notice of intent is not a request for competitive quotations. However, all responsible sources may submit a capability statement for the Government to review. The Government will consider responses received by the deadline set in this notice. Information received will normally be considered solely for the purpose of determining whether or not to conduct a full and open competitive procurement or a small business set aside competitive procurement. The Government will not pay for any information received in response to this announcement. The associated North American Industrial Classification System (NAICS) code for this procurement is 314910, with a small business size standard of 500 employees. A determination not to compete this requirement based upon responses to this notice is solely within the discretion of the Government.
